Programa computacional para um simulador de vôo

Os simuladores de vôo têm sido uma importante ferramenta para treinamento de pilotos e análise de vôo sem ter que se desembolsar grandes quantias monetárias, economizando combustível e evitando acidentes. Conseqüentemente, a demanda por simuladores de vôo tem aumentado tanto na indústria quanto...

Full description

Bibliographic Details
Main Author: Carlos Eduardo Beluzo
Other Authors: Eduardo Morgado Belo
Language:Portuguese
Published: Universidade de São Paulo 2006
Subjects:
Online Access:http://www.teses.usp.br/teses/disponiveis/18/18135/tde-08012016-114920/
id ndltd-IBICT-oai-teses.usp.br-tde-08012016-114920
record_format oai_dc
spelling ndltd-IBICT-oai-teses.usp.br-tde-08012016-1149202019-01-22T01:12:43Z Programa computacional para um simulador de vôo A computer program for a flight simulator Carlos Eduardo Beluzo Eduardo Morgado Belo Carlos De Marqui Junior Roseli Aparecida Francelin Romero Dinâmica de vôo Runge-Kutta Simulação Simulador de vôo Dynamics of flight Flight simulator Runge-Kutta Simulation Os simuladores de vôo têm sido uma importante ferramenta para treinamento de pilotos e análise de vôo sem ter que se desembolsar grandes quantias monetárias, economizando combustível e evitando acidentes. Conseqüentemente, a demanda por simuladores de vôo tem aumentado tanto na indústria quanto na pesquisa. Com o intuito de futuramente construir um simulador de vôo, foi desenvolvido um projeto para elaboração de um software capaz de simular uma aeronave em vôo, do ponto de vista de dinâmica de vôo. O software SIMAERO foi desenvolvido na linguagem de programação C++ e simula a dinâmica de vôo de uma aeronave. Esta simulação consiste em resolver as equações de movimento da aeronave, utilizando o modelo matemático de equações diferenciais ordinárias proposto por ETKIN & REID, et al (1996). O modelo matemático é solucionado através do método de integração numérica Runge-Kutta de 4ª ordem conforme apresentado em CONTE (1977). Como parâmetros de entrada são informadas as seguintes características da aeronave: dados geométricos, dados aerodinâmicos e derivadas de estabilidade. Os resultados das simulações são apresentados em gráficos cartesianos e gravados em arquivos. Os gráficos são úteis para que possa ser feita uma posterior análise do comportamento da aeronave. Os arquivos gravados com os resultados das simulações podem ser utilizados em alguma aplicação futura, como sinas de entrada para uma plataforma de simulação, por exemplo. Neste trabalho será descrito como o SIMAERO foi desenvolvido e ao final serão apresentados alguns resultados obtidos. Flight simulators have been an important tool for pilots training and for flight analyses, without having to spend a high quantity of money, saving gas and prevent accidents. Because of this, the demand for flight simulators has increased both in industry and in research centers. With the objective of in future build a flight simulator, a project to develop a software that is able to simulate the dynamics of flight of a flying aircraft was developed. The SIMAERO software was developed using C++ and its principal functionality is to simulate the dynamics of flight of an aircraft. This simulation basically is the solution of the system of motion equations of the aircraft, using the mathematical model described by ETKIN & REID, et al (1996). The mathematical model is solved using the 4th order Runge-Kutta numeric integration method, as presented in CONTE (1977). For the simulation, the geometric data, the aerodynamic data, and the dimensional derivates are passed to the software as input arguments. The results of the simulations are displayed as cartesians graphics and recorded as data files. The graphics are useful for visual analyses of the aircraft behavior, and the file, with the results of the simulation, can be used as input data for ground based simulator, for example. In this work, the development of the software SIMAERO will be presented, and then some results of the simulation of one aircraft will be shown. 2006-04-27 info:eu-repo/semantics/publishedVersion info:eu-repo/semantics/masterThesis http://www.teses.usp.br/teses/disponiveis/18/18135/tde-08012016-114920/ por info:eu-repo/semantics/openAccess Universidade de São Paulo Engenharia Mecânica USP BR reponame:Biblioteca Digital de Teses e Dissertações da USP instname:Universidade de São Paulo instacron:USP
collection NDLTD
language Portuguese
sources NDLTD
topic Dinâmica de vôo
Runge-Kutta
Simulação
Simulador de vôo
Dynamics of flight
Flight simulator
Runge-Kutta
Simulation
spellingShingle Dinâmica de vôo
Runge-Kutta
Simulação
Simulador de vôo
Dynamics of flight
Flight simulator
Runge-Kutta
Simulation
Carlos Eduardo Beluzo
Programa computacional para um simulador de vôo
description Os simuladores de vôo têm sido uma importante ferramenta para treinamento de pilotos e análise de vôo sem ter que se desembolsar grandes quantias monetárias, economizando combustível e evitando acidentes. Conseqüentemente, a demanda por simuladores de vôo tem aumentado tanto na indústria quanto na pesquisa. Com o intuito de futuramente construir um simulador de vôo, foi desenvolvido um projeto para elaboração de um software capaz de simular uma aeronave em vôo, do ponto de vista de dinâmica de vôo. O software SIMAERO foi desenvolvido na linguagem de programação C++ e simula a dinâmica de vôo de uma aeronave. Esta simulação consiste em resolver as equações de movimento da aeronave, utilizando o modelo matemático de equações diferenciais ordinárias proposto por ETKIN & REID, et al (1996). O modelo matemático é solucionado através do método de integração numérica Runge-Kutta de 4ª ordem conforme apresentado em CONTE (1977). Como parâmetros de entrada são informadas as seguintes características da aeronave: dados geométricos, dados aerodinâmicos e derivadas de estabilidade. Os resultados das simulações são apresentados em gráficos cartesianos e gravados em arquivos. Os gráficos são úteis para que possa ser feita uma posterior análise do comportamento da aeronave. Os arquivos gravados com os resultados das simulações podem ser utilizados em alguma aplicação futura, como sinas de entrada para uma plataforma de simulação, por exemplo. Neste trabalho será descrito como o SIMAERO foi desenvolvido e ao final serão apresentados alguns resultados obtidos. === Flight simulators have been an important tool for pilots training and for flight analyses, without having to spend a high quantity of money, saving gas and prevent accidents. Because of this, the demand for flight simulators has increased both in industry and in research centers. With the objective of in future build a flight simulator, a project to develop a software that is able to simulate the dynamics of flight of a flying aircraft was developed. The SIMAERO software was developed using C++ and its principal functionality is to simulate the dynamics of flight of an aircraft. This simulation basically is the solution of the system of motion equations of the aircraft, using the mathematical model described by ETKIN & REID, et al (1996). The mathematical model is solved using the 4th order Runge-Kutta numeric integration method, as presented in CONTE (1977). For the simulation, the geometric data, the aerodynamic data, and the dimensional derivates are passed to the software as input arguments. The results of the simulations are displayed as cartesians graphics and recorded as data files. The graphics are useful for visual analyses of the aircraft behavior, and the file, with the results of the simulation, can be used as input data for ground based simulator, for example. In this work, the development of the software SIMAERO will be presented, and then some results of the simulation of one aircraft will be shown.
author2 Eduardo Morgado Belo
author_facet Eduardo Morgado Belo
Carlos Eduardo Beluzo
author Carlos Eduardo Beluzo
author_sort Carlos Eduardo Beluzo
title Programa computacional para um simulador de vôo
title_short Programa computacional para um simulador de vôo
title_full Programa computacional para um simulador de vôo
title_fullStr Programa computacional para um simulador de vôo
title_full_unstemmed Programa computacional para um simulador de vôo
title_sort programa computacional para um simulador de vôo
publisher Universidade de São Paulo
publishDate 2006
url http://www.teses.usp.br/teses/disponiveis/18/18135/tde-08012016-114920/
work_keys_str_mv AT carloseduardobeluzo programacomputacionalparaumsimuladordevoo
AT carloseduardobeluzo acomputerprogramforaflightsimulator
_version_ 1718931962048020480